About Ceriatone
We have new and used Ceriatone gear available on our website for fast direct delivery direct to you from across sellers in all areas of the USA & UK.
Ceriatone is a Malaysian company that specialises in handcrafted tube amplifiers and amp kits. Founded by Nik “Ceriatone” in 2000, the company has gained a strong reputation for creating high-quality, reliable, and affordable amps inspired by classic designs. Ceriatone is known for replicating and improving upon legendary amp circuits, such as those used by Fender, Marshall, and Vox, while also offering custom and boutique-style amplifiers. Their products are popular among musicians and builders who seek vintage-style tone, exceptional craftsmanship, and flexibility, making Ceriatone a respected name in the world of amplifier design.

Overdrive
Overdrive is a popular guitar effect that creates a warm, distorted sound by amplifying the signal of an electric guitar, typically using a pedal or an amp’s built-in circuit. The effect simulates the natural distortion that occurs when a tube amplifier is pushed to its limit, creating a rich, harmonic response that adds sustain, warmth, and character to the tone. Overdrive pedals are commonly used to add grit and growl to a clean tone without the harshness of full distortion.
The overdrive effect works by boosting the input signal, causing the amplifier to break up and clip the waveform, resulting in a smooth, musical distortion. This is often more subtle and less aggressive than other forms of distortion, making overdrive pedals ideal for blues, classic rock, and country players who seek a dynamic sound that responds to their playing touch. Overdrive pedals can be used in conjunction with other effects like delay and reverb to shape a more complex, evolving sound. Popular overdrive pedals include the Ibanez Tube Screamer, the Fulltone OCD, and the Boss OD-3, each offering different tonal characteristics, from smooth and bluesy to punchy and aggressive.
Pedal
A pedal is an electronic device that alters the sound of an electric guitar by applying various effects. Pedals are typically connected in a series between the guitar and amplifier, allowing guitarists to switch effects on and off with their feet while playing.
This enables musicians to quickly and easily change their sound, adding versatility and creativity to their performances.
Pedals are essential tools in many musical genres, including rock, blues, jazz, and metal, allowing artists to craft distinctive and dynamic soundscapes.
